How to Develop Custom Schema APIs in WordPress
Step 1: Define the Schema Structure
Before developing the schema API, determine the required data fields and relationships.
Step 2: Create a Custom JSON-LD Schema
To add structured data to WordPress pages, use JSON-LD format.
Example: Adding Product Schema Markup to WordPress
function add_product_schema() {
if (is_singular('product')) {
global $post;
$schema = [
"@context" => "https://schema.org/",
"@type" => "Product",
"name" => get_the_title($post->ID),
"description" => get_the_excerpt($post->ID),
"image" => get_the_post_thumbnail_url($post->ID),
"offers" => [
"@type" => "Offer",
"price" => get_post_meta($post->ID, '_price', true),
"priceCurrency" => "USD",
"availability" => "https://schema.org/InStock"
]
];
echo '<script type="application/ld+json">' . json_encode($schema) . '</script>';
}
}
add_action('wp_head', 'add_product_schema');
🔹 Use Case: This adds structured data for WooCommerce product pages, helping search engines understand the product details.
Step 3: Create a Custom REST API Endpoint with Schema
Expose structured data via WordPress REST API.
Example: Registering a Custom REST API Endpoint
function custom_schema_api_endpoint() {
register_rest_route('custom-schema/v1', '/data/', array(
'methods' => 'GET',
'callback' => 'get_custom_schema_data',
));
}
function get_custom_schema_data() {
$data = array(
"@context" => "https://schema.org/",
"@type" => "Article",
"headline" => "How to Develop Custom Schema APIs in WordPress",
"author" => "John Doe",
"datePublished" => "2024-06-15"
);
return rest_ensure_response($data);
}
add_action('rest_api_init', 'custom_schema_api_endpoint');
🔹 Use Case: Exposes structured schema data for external applications via REST API.
Step 4: Implement GraphQL Schema for Custom Queries
If you’re using GraphQL with WordPress, define a GraphQL schema.
Example: Querying Custom Schema Data with GraphQL
query {
post(id: "1") {
title
seo {
metaDescription
schemaType
}
}
}
🔹 Use Case: Retrieves custom schema metadata for SEO-optimized WordPress posts.
Best Practices for WordPress Custom Schema APIs Development
✔ Follow Schema.org Guidelines – Ensure structured data adheres to Google’s rich results standards.
✔ Optimize API Responses – Reduce load times by caching schema API responses.
✔ Use Secure Authentication – Protect API endpoints with authentication methods like OAuth or API keys.
✔ Ensure Scalability – Use efficient database queries to handle high traffic loads.
✔ Test with Google’s Rich Results Tool – Validate schema markup for SEO benefits.
Frequently Asked Questions (FAQs)
1. What is WordPress custom schema APIs development?
It refers to creating structured data APIs in WordPress to enhance SEO, data organization, and external integrations using JSON-LD, REST API, or GraphQL.
2. Why is structured data important for WordPress?
Structured data helps search engines understand website content better, leading to rich snippets, enhanced rankings, and improved user experience.
3. Can I add custom schema markup without coding?
Yes! You can use plugins like Schema Pro or Yoast SEO. However, custom APIs require coding for flexibility.
4. How do I test my custom schema markup?
Use Google’s Rich Results Test or Schema Markup Validator to ensure the schema is correctly implemented.
5. What’s the difference between JSON-LD and REST API-based schema?
- JSON-LD: Adds structured data directly in WordPress pages.
- REST API schema: Exposes structured data to external applications.
